Concrete roads, sidewalks, flooring become unstable and unsettled in due course. You need to correct this or the issue can increase and turn more expensive. Concrete lifting with polyurethane foam is the best solution in comparison to slab piers, mud-jacking, and replacement.
Polyurethane foam material available in the market differs. Wrong foam usage can cause issues and cost more. So, first understand about the lifting foam before purchasing it for application.
In polyurethane foam concrete lifting method not just expansion, but even the cure times and adhesion are crucial.
Foam response time
If the polyurethane foam reacts very slowly then it is good for filling voids, but raising concrete can be a disaster. Slowly reacting material travels beneath and beyond slab area you are repairing and expand. Thus, multiple slabs get lifted with the foam bridge created beneath. For regaining control, it is necessary to cut through foam layer and try the lift again. You lose money and time.
Foam elasticity
It is obvious that when you lift slab from one side the other side lowers. When concrete slab gets raised from one side and you can rock the injected foam to level the slab. The foam needs to remain pliable for sufficient time for slab lifting and levelling. Good concrete lifting foam needs to have setup time of 15 seconds and remain supple for 15 minutes.
Foam density
Many people think that 4 lb. foam needs to be used but why not save money using 2 lb. foam. A one-cubit foot box needs just 2 pounds of 2lb. to fill. You can even fill it with 4 pounds of 4 lb. to get same result. Double the amount of material means double the expense. Actual difference in both is foam density. The box has less foam and more air, while using 2 lb. polyurethane material.
Foam adhesion
The raising foam needs to elevate the concrete but must not hold on to it because it can adhere and lock adjoining slabs. Therefore, foam that sets up with tough exterior skin is needed. The skin removes adhesion to adjacent concrete slabs.
Foam forcefulness
Efficient expansion rate for concrete lifting is 20-25 times original value.
